The wedge - what to build better

Recurring complaint themes mined from incumbents' own user reviews. These are the openings:

  • System performance and speed issues - Frequent slowdowns, lags, freezes, and slow load times that disrupt clinical workflows and charting during patient sessions. (28 mentions)
  • Unreliable video and telehealth functionality - Unstable video sessions, connection drops, sync issues, Bluetooth incompatibility, and limited group video features. (11 mentions)
  • Complex insurance billing and claims processing - Confusing billing workflows, manual claim steps, limited payer integrations, claim generation failures, and payment tracking difficulties. (9 mentions)
  • Steep learning curve and complex configuration - Difficult onboarding, complex setup, workflow customization takes significant time, and non-intuitive feature navigation. (12 mentions)
  • Limited customization and data management - Insufficient form/assessment customization, inability to copy client data across programs, limited report options, and bulk action gaps. (8 mentions)
  • Clunky and outdated user interface - Poor UI/UX design, unintuitive navigation, redundant displays, generic client portal appearance, and awkward screen transitions. (10 mentions)
  • Inconsistent customer support quality - Slow response times, unresponsive helpdesk, ticketing system failures, limited post-implementation support, and difficulty reaching support. (10 mentions)
  • Pricing model misaligned with practice size - High costs for solo practitioners and small teams, forced payment for unused features, and expensive add-ons (video, integrations). (7 mentions)
